Output e50c77664697c8bcfd876ba65bb52cb227ac908cbfbee08c9ff878f60948e829:55

value
24515
script pubkey
OP_0 OP_PUSHBYTES_20 3df20015403fb971d2f03dfb6e297111b8043623
address
bc1q8heqq92q87uhr5hs8haku2t3zxuqgd3rmxvmwv
transaction
e50c77664697c8bcfd876ba65bb52cb227ac908cbfbee08c9ff878f60948e829
confirmations
8113
spent
true